Best’s Special Report: U.S. Property/Casualty Industry Sees Significantly Improved Underwriting Gain in First Nine Months of 2025

December 12, 2025

The U.S. property/casualty industry recorded a $35 billion net underwriting gain in the first nine months of 2025, a significant improvement from the nearly $4 billion gain recorded in the same prior-year period, according to a new AM Best report. TULSA COUNTY, OKLAHOMA FLOOD MAPS BECOME FINAL

December 11, 2025

The following information was released by FEMA:. New flood maps have been finalized and will become effective on June 10, 2026, for Tulsa County, Oklahoma. Residents with federally backed mortgages must have flood insurance if their structures are in the Special Flood Hazard Area.
